This versatile probiotic strain is well-known for its supportive role in digestive health. Withstanding the harsh acidic environment of the stomach and thriving in the intestines, Lactobacillus fermentum shines particularly in maintaining gut balance. By outmaneuvering harmful pathogens and boosting the population of friendly microbes, it helps create a healthy environment within your gut.

Studies have shown that Lactobacillus fermentum can help manage digestive issues like diarrhea, constipation, and irritable bowel syndrome, making it a valuable tool for keeping your digestive health in check.

So, how exactly does Lactobacillus fermentum help enhance digestion? First, it supports the integrity of the intestinal lining, managing inflammation and boosting nutrient absorption. Second, by fermenting dietary fibers, it aids in producing short-chain fatty acids, which foster a healthy gut environment.

When it comes to incorporating Lactobacillus fermentum into your daily life, there are plenty of options. Probiotic-rich foods such as yogurt, kefir, sauerkraut, and kimchi are an excellent source, while supplements specifically formulated with this beneficial strain provide a concentrated dose of gut-friendly bacteria.

In addition to aiding digestion, Lactobacillus fermentum boasts a variety of health benefits, including:

  • Immune System Support: This probiotic can strengthen the immune system, reducing the frequency of infections like upper respiratory tract infections.
  • Vaginal and Urinary Tract Health: Lactobacillus fermentum helps maintain a healthy balance of good bacteria in the vagina, reducing the risk of vaginal yeast infections and urinary tract infections.
  • Breast Health and Lactation Support: A specific strain of Lactobacillus fermentum found in human breast milk can alleviate breast discomfort and resolve mammary dysbiosis, supporting breast health during breastfeeding and the immune system for both mother and baby.
  • Mood and Weight Management: While not exclusive to Lactobacillus fermentum, probiotics including this strain may help with weight regulation and improve mood in women.
